Canadian Online Gambling Committee To Prove Industry Can Be Regulated
July 11th, 2010 – by Glen Farmer

Online gambling has recently been legalized in Quebec, with the province deciding to regulate and govern the games. The provincial government has created a committee of five officials to monitor the launch of Loto Quebec’s new Internet gambling website.

In the upcoming months, Loto Quebec will launch their online gambling site that will initially offer a regulated and taxed form of online poker, set to capitalize off of the already burgeoning online poker industry.

Online gambling is already deeply rooted in North America, with several of the gambling sites hailing from Kahnawake, an Indian reserve based in Quebec itself. Online gambling is almost universally unregulated in North America, with Quebec being one of the very few exceptions.

Quebec has decided to regulate online gambling in order to generate tax revenue from the money invariably spent on online gambling. The commission has been established in order to study the impacts of online gambling in the province, particularly as it pertains to pathological gambling.

The study will take place over a period of three years.

The United States has yet to capitalize on the enormous tax potential found in online gambling. It has been estimated that over $70 billion dollars in tax revenue could be collected over ten years.

Legislative attempts are underway in order to push the possibility of regulated USA online gambling. Several bills are in congress, particularly Barney Frank’s HR 2267, in order to overturn the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act.
